Vagrant Skeleton

This is the Vagrant skeleton that we use at Better Brief. It's meant to form a "as close as possible" base to our live servers to keep fragmentation of environments to a minimum. There is obviously the advantage of easily portable development environments!

Guest OS

We're using a CentOS 6.5 OS, image from puppet labs (thanks)

However, there shouldn't be much issue using these scrips on the following OS's:

  • RHEL
  • Fedora
  • Amazon Linux

Automation and provisioning

We use as much automation as possible during provisioning so that our scripts can be used on other environments and not just on Vagrant boxes.

Purpose

The main purpose for this skeleton is for developing SilverStripe sites (as that's our primary framework) so we include a basic environment file for that. However, the skeleton can easily be adapted for any other framework that you want to host on CentOS

Usage

To get up and running is very simple.

  1. Copy this repo to a new folder where you develop
  2. Add SQL dump(s) to the database folder with the name of the database the same as the filename
  3. Checkout your PHP code to folder www (this is the webroot)
  4. Go to the command line and # vagrant up

This will run the default webserver with the default php modules we need installed. It will also pull in the database(s) automatically.

Customisations

Edit the Vagrantfile to enable or disable install scripts as they are required.
